Classic Girlfriend Nicknames

  • Honey: A timeless sweetener, this nickname conveys warmth and affection, much like the natural sweetener itself.
  • Baby: One of the most common pet names, it suggests a protective, caring dynamic and is used across many cultures.
  • Sweetheart: A classic term that emphasizes her kind and loving nature, often used in both casual and formal romantic contexts.
  • Darling: An endearing term that has been used for centuries, implying that she is dearly loved and cherished.
  • Love: Simple and direct, this nickname works as a standalone term of endearment and is popular in British English.
  • Babe: A casual, affectionate nickname that is widely used among couples, often interchangeable with ‘baby’.
  • Dear: A gentle, respectful nickname that conveys fondness and is often used in more traditional relationships.
  • Angel: Suggests she is pure, kind, and a blessing in your life, often used when she does something thoughtful.
  • Princess: Implies she is treated with royalty and special care, perfect for a girlfriend who loves being pampered.
  • Sunshine: For the girlfriend who brightens your day, this nickname highlights her positive energy and cheerful personality.

Cute Girlfriend Nicknames

  • Cutie: A straightforward, affectionate nickname that highlights her adorable qualities, suitable for any relationship stage.
  • Snugglebug: Perfect for a girlfriend who loves cuddling, this nickname combines warmth and playfulness.
  • Peaches: A sweet, fruity nickname that suggests she is soft, sweet, and delightful, often used in Southern US culture.
  • Cupcake: A dessert-inspired nickname that implies she is sweet, cute, and a treat to be around.
  • Buttercup: A flower name that also sounds affectionate, evoking a sunny, cheerful personality.
  • Sweetie Pie: An extra-sweet variation of ‘sweetie’, this nickname is ideal for a girlfriend who is genuinely kind and loving.
  • Pumpkin: A popular fall-themed nickname that is both cute and comforting, often used in North America.
  • Muffin: A baked-good nickname that suggests she is warm, soft, and delightful, similar to ‘cupcake’.
  • Boo: A playful, affectionate term that originated in African American Vernacular English and is now widely used among couples.
  • Lovebug: Combines ‘love’ and ‘bug’ to create a cute, affectionate nickname for a girlfriend who is always on your mind.

Tips for Using a Girlfriend Nickname

  • Start naturally: Introduce the nickname in a casual, affectionate moment rather than making a formal announcement. For example, use it during a sweet text or while cuddling.
  • Check her reaction: Pay attention to whether she smiles, laughs, or seems uncomfortable. If she doesn’t respond positively, ask if she likes it or if she prefers something else.
  • Consider context: Some nicknames are best kept private between the two of you, especially if they are very personal or silly. Avoid using overly intimate nicknames in public or around family unless she is comfortable with it.

What is the most popular nickname for a girlfriend?

Popularity varies by region and relationship, but 'Baby', 'Honey', and 'Babe' are consistently among the most common nicknames for girlfriends worldwide.

What is a cute nickname for a girlfriend?

Cute options include 'Snugglebug', 'Cupcake', and 'Lovebug'. These work best when you want to express affection in a playful, tender way.

How do you create a nickname for a girlfriend?

You can create a nickname by shortening her name, using a shared interest, combining affectionate words, or picking a trait you love about her. For example, if she loves stars, 'Starlight' could be a unique choice.
